Kili acquires NFC microSD pioneer DeviceFidelity

NFC-on-microSD pioneer DeviceFidelity has been acquired by Kili Technology, a payments processing solution provider which launched an mPOS solution-on-a-chip range last month.

DeviceFidelity will now operate as a subsidiary of Kili with founders Deepak Jain and Amitaabh Malhotra continuing to manage the division. The companys existing secure microSD and NFC Business Cards products will continue to be offered and an exciting new lineup of mobile point of sale and wearable products will be developed, DeviceFidelity says.

DeviceFidelity has long pioneered the role of mobile devices as the leading platform of choice for secure transactions; a vision now being embraced by some of the planets most powerful technology and payments companies Jain says.

Kilis vision and product strategy is a great fit for us and this merger will accelerate our plans to bring innovative, easy to deploy, end-to-end mobile solutions to merchants, consumers, telecom operators and financial institutions.

Combining DeviceFidelitys highly accomplished team and proven track record with our vast portfolio of intellectual property will help accelerate our growth plans adds Greg Wolfond, founder of Kili Technology.

DeviceFidelity introduced its first NFC microSD device in 2009 and signed a deal with Visa in 2010 for its devices to be used in a number of early NFC payments field tests. The companys products include a range of cases that enable NFC functionality to be added to early iPhones that lack in-built NFC capabilities.
